The 2005 Kia Rio has 1 NHTSA recall campaign affecting an estimated 90,865 vehicles. Recall repairs are always free at any authorized dealer. Owners have filed 46 complaints with NHTSA, most often about the engine and engine cooling. Last updated July 5, 2026.

Recall campaigns

CHILD SEAT 05V557000 2005-12-12 90,865 affected
Defect

CERTAIN PASSENGER VEHICLES FAIL TO CONFORM TO THE REQUIREMENTS OF FEDERAL MOTOR VEHICLE SAFETY STANDARD NO. 225, 'CHILD RESTRAINT ANCHORAGE SYSTEMS.' CERTAIN CHILD RESTRAINT ANCHORS WILL NOT FULLY LATCH ONTO THE LOWER LATCH ANCHORS LOCATED BETWEEN THE REAR SEAT BACK AND REAR SEAT CUSHION BECAUSE OF INTERFERENCE…

Consequence

IN THE EVENT OF A VEHICLE CRASH, IF THE CHILD SEAT IS NOT PROPERLY INSTALLED, PERSONAL INJURY OR DEATH COULD OCCUR.

Remedy

D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E LOWER ANCHORS FREE OF CHARGE. THE RECALL BEGAN ON JANUARY 30, 2006. OWNERS MAY CONTACT KIA AT 1-800-333-4542.
